Original Tender Description

The Education Recruitment Advertising and Resourcing Services Framework Agreement supports the public sector with education recruitment advertising and resourcing as well as student recruitment advertising. The current framework is made up of 2 lots as described below; Lot 1 - Education Recruitment Advertising & Resourcing Education Recruitment Advertising and Resourcing which range from all types of advertising services including recruitment of staff, advertisement creation and production, type setting and copy writing, media buying, art direction, brand management and where required full creative services for new advertising campaigns. Lot 2 - Student Recruitment Marketing Student Recruitment Advertising marketing to attract UK and overseas students and is focussed on media buying and advertisement placement.
